Hi,

 

I would like to install osCommerce Online Merchant v2.2 Release Candidate 2a and

I have installed WAMP5(MySQL - 5.0.21-community-nt,phpMyAdmin - 2.8.0.3,Apache 2.0.55) already.

 

But i'm realy newbie, i can not understand even read many times at the site the explaination.

here the steps I took then I got problem

 

1. Extract oscommerce to c:\wamp\www\catalog\

2. open ie: localhost\catalog\install\install.php

show up this page and i filled

 

database server : C:\wamp\mysql\data\test

username : admin

password : admin

database name : test

 

error message :here was a problem connecting to the database server. The following error had occured:

 

Unknown MySQL server host 'C' (11001)

 

Please verify the connection parameters and try again.

 

My question is :

1. How to fix it ?

2. is that database problem and how to create database ?

3. Is my wamp5 not support osCommerce ?

 

Hope your help

enter localhost instead of 'C:\wamp\mysql\data\test'
